OBO - OBPY Party Amend Request Issue (Doc ID 2915603.1)

Last updated on DECEMBER 27, 2022

Applies to:

Oracle Banking Origination - Version 14.5.0.0.0 to 14.6.0.0.0 [Release 14]
Information in this document applies to any platform.

Goal

 On : 14.5.0.0.0 version, Implementation Support

OBO - OBPY Party Amend Request Issue
We received a obpy-retail-amendment-processflow_PAMD.jso as a hotfix ,However after deploying the json and testing, we are still getting the JSONObject ['Owners'] is not a JSONObject when we submit the amend request, and it goes to manual retry.


ERROR
-----------------------
'JSONObject ['Owners'] is not a JSONObject'.


STEPS
-----------------------
The issue can be reproduced at will with the following steps:
1. Make any changes for an existing customer in saving account or Loan Origination Process in OBO, it generates an amendment request.
2. Follow up this amend process and arrive at approval stage
3. When submitted from Approval stage, all the amend requests fail with 'JSONObject ['Owners'] is not a JSONObject'.
4. Same error re-appears even if we submit from manual retry.

BUSINESS IMPACT
-----------------------
The issue has the following business impact:
Due to this issue, users cannot amend and submit OBPY Party Request
